URWIS - a student-built water drone designed to support rescue teams
Students at Gdańsk University of Technology are developing an unmanned surface vessel designed to support rescue services during operations at sea, on lakes and other bodies of water. URWIS is intended to reach people in need of assistance faster than rescue personnel and deliver a flotation device, increasing their chances of remaining safely afloat until a rescue team arrives. Call for applications for the Proof of Concept research voucher
Researchers, doctoral students and biotechnology startups may apply for support worth up to PLN 50,000 for pilot biomedical and biotechnological research. Applications for the Proof of Concept research voucher under the POL-OPENSCREEN 2.0 programme may be submitted by 30 June 2026.
